Output 34dededb624c3028d368fa311072dfef613079b6eeaee5450555bb9b40098e8e:1

value
12270213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c45bea6ba28d256e1931a6e9a087ba158a376c OP_EQUAL
address
379328LvMxNvqcXxRcPQEd8xaDPmCUdTiV
transaction
34dededb624c3028d368fa311072dfef613079b6eeaee5450555bb9b40098e8e
spent
true